1. Demystifying the “Mixture of Experts” (MoE)
Sarvam AI announced their MoE architecture implementation as their most important announcement. The traditional model requires activation of all “neurons” and parameters for each word generated by the system. The system becomes slow and requires excessive processing power to perform this task.
My Artificial Intelligence Course training taught me that MoE operates as a dedicated medical facility. The “router” (a neural network component) directs the query to only the most relevant “experts” instead of all doctors accessing every patient.
- The Sarvam Connection: Sarvam-30B activates only 1 billion parameters per token.
- The Learning: My experience creating a mini-MoE project at BIA showed me that Sarvam uses their multilingual chatbot “Vikram” because it operates on basic mobile phones. The system operates with complete efficiency because of its intelligent technology.
2. Understanding “Sovereign AI” and Data Curation
The Artificial Intelligence Course explains the ethical and technical significance of “Sovereign AI” which we frequently encounter as a term. Global models like GPT-4 are trained primarily on Western data which creates “digital colonial” biases that result in Indian linguistic elements being excluded from their training data.
At the Boston Institute of Analytics, our Natural Language Processing (NLP) and Data Engineering modules demonstrated that a model’s performance depends entirely on the quality of its training data.
- The Sarvam Connection: Sarvam AI developed their models through training on 16 trillion tokens which included extensive material in more than 20 Indian languages and “code-mixed” languages (Hinglish, Kan-English, etc.).
- The Learning: My discovery about Sarvam established that the company goes beyond simple translation work because it develops a complete “cultural engine.” The synthetic data generation coursework which I completed showed me how Sarvam used its technology to bridge linguistic gaps in digital content that existed in regional languages.
3. The Power of On-Device “Edge AI”
The company Sarvam AI introduced its upcoming product Sarvam Kaze which features AI-powered wearable glasses designed and developed in India. A person not trained to recognize artificial intelligence systems will perceive this object as a regular electronic device. The Artificial Intelligence Course completion proves that this technology demonstrates advanced Model Compression and Edge Computing capabilities.
The BIA program included MLOps training that lasted several weeks to teach us how to create a smaller version of a large model which could operate on a chip without internet access.
- The Sarvam Connection: The speech model requires only 294MB of storage space and achieves playback speeds that exceed real-time performance by 8.5 times on mobile chipsets.
- The Learning: I learned how to balance the two requirements of “Latency” and “Accuracy” for system performance. The achievement of creating a 110-language translation model which operates within a 334MB space requirement remained beyond my understanding until my training began.
